Encrypted-drive access via undisclosed physical bypass
Published Sep 15, 2021 · Updated Aug 10, 2026
BitLocker bypass in affected Windows releases allows physically proximate attackers to access encrypted system-drive data. Microsoft identifies the locus only as BitLocker Device Encryption on the system storage device and has not disclosed the faulty operation. Exploitation requires physical access to a powered-off system; the bounded consequence is unauthorized access to encrypted data.
